Job Summary: 

The Account Manager – Life Sciences will provide support for customers of Surescripts within the growing vertical of Life Sciences. The Account Manager will work directly with the client/s to understand their business needs and challenges, influence adoption and utilization of our products and services, address business issues, provide reporting to show valuable insights, and advance planned goals and strategy. In addition, the Account Manager will be responsible for growth, retention, and customer satisfaction within their client group. They will collaborate with many groups within Surescripts, most notably Sales, Customer Support, Product Innovation, Data & Analytics, Marketing, & Finance to drive valued results. 

Responsibilities: 

  • Develop highly effective relationships with customers and solicit feedback to bring back to internal business units. 

  • Proactively assess client business needs and partner in building a roadmap to address those needs. 

  • Translate customer business needs into service requirements. 

  • Ensure customers know the benefits and value of Surescripts products to help drive adoption and utilization of Surescripts products. 

  • Apply understanding of customers’ strategic plans and share with internal partners. 

  • Protect, retain, and grow customer base. 

  • Identify and manage growth opportunities through lead generation to sales. 

  • Identify opportunities to increase utilization and adoption of products and services. 

  • Lead the preparation and design of account reviews to evaluate client demands and product utilization. 

  • Propose business enhancements to reduce errors, increase routing efficiency, and growth of enablement and utilization of Surescripts products 

  • Coordinate pilots and early adoption opportunities with our customers to gain adoption and utilization. 

  • Escalate customer concerns that require intervention from management or other internal business units. 

  • Train and educate other Account Managers in your subject matter expertise or on learnings you have had with a customer/s.

  • Attend annual internal meetings & select conferences within the United States (1-3 times a year approximately).

What We Do

Since 2001, we've been building an industrial-strength health information network designed to increase patient safety, lower costs and improve quality of care.

THE SURESCRIPTS NETWORK ALLIANCE®

Built to Transform Interactions between Clinicians, Pharmacists and Patients

The Surescripts Network Alliance unites virtually all electronic health records (EHR) vendors, pharmacy benefit managers (PBMs), pharmacies and clinicians, plus an increasing number of health plans, long-term and post-acute care organizations, specialty hubs and specialty pharmacy organizations.
